Our Story
Founded in 2014, Kings Indian Chess has trained approximately 50 students every year since 2014 โ more than 500 young players and counting. From first moves to rated tournament play, we meet students where they are and take them further. Kings Indian Chess is run by Pragathi USA, a 501(c)(3) non-profit of compassionate, self-driven volunteers — so giving back is part of who we are. Proceeds from our programs support Pragathi USA's work, including local charities and orphanages in India that serve socially and economically challenged children. Our shared goal is simple: to inspire individuals to achieve their full potential.

FIDE Master ยท USCF Life Master ยท VCF Chess Coach of the Year
Greg Acholonu is a FIDE Master and USCF Life Master who has been among the strongest players in the DC–Maryland–Virginia region for four decades. He earned the National Master title in 1982, rose to Senior Master, and holds the FIDE Master title. A four-time U.S. Chess Center Champion and the 1992 Maryland Closed Champion, Greg was honored by the Virginia Chess Federation as its Chess Coach of the Year.
Greg’s patient, question-driven teaching helps students at every level think for themselves at the board. FIDE rating 2251 — view his official FIDE profile →
